Radio shock jock Howard Stern can rest easy--he won't face federal decency standards when he moves to satellite radio, at least for now.
The U.S. Federal Communications Commission rejected a request from a radio broadcaster to consider applying federal indecency limits to pay satellite radio services like Sirius Satellite Radio, where Stern is headed in 2006
